Purpose
The purpose of the ASA Graduate Scholarship Program is to attract, identify, and assist outstanding graduate students pursuing careers within the field of concrete with a significant interest in the shotcrete process.
Program Summary
The ASA Graduate Scholarships are available to applicants who have been accepted into a graduate program in the field of concrete at the time of application to an accredited college or university within the United States or at Laval University in Canada. To receive consideration for an ASA Graduate Scholarship, the applicant needs only to submit one application. Based on essays, submitted data, and references, the ASA Scholarship Committee will select scholarship recipients who appear to have the strongest combination of interest and potential for professional success in the shotcrete industry.
Two $3,000 (USD) awards are available through the American Shotcrete Association (ASA) for the 2009-2010 academic year. One scholarship will be awarded to a graduate student attending an accredited college or university within the United States and the second scholarship will be awarded to a graduate student attending Laval University in Canada.
Each ASA Graduate Scholarship award consists of a stipend of $3,000 (USD) and is paid in 2 installments of one thousand five hundred dollars ($1,500 USD) directly to the student's educational institution. The first payment will be made in the fall 2009 and the second in the early winter of 2010.

The BDPA Education & Technology Foundation is proud to open up the application period for any graduating high school student or current college student interested in the 2009 Eli Lilly and Company Scholarship for BDPA Students!
The purpose of the Lilly/BDPA Scholarship is to recognize outstanding minority students, with an interest in information technology, who make significant contributions to society. Applicants must excel academically, show exceptional leadership potential, and make an impact on their communities through service to others.
Lilly/BDPA Scholars will be awarded a one-time $2,500 scholarship that may be used to pursue an information technology focused degree at an accredited four-year college or university of their choice. The Lilly/BDPA Scholarship may be used to supplement benefits from the college or university a student plans to attend and fellowships from other foundations or organizations. Students may use the scholarship to cover the cost of tuition, fees, books, room and board, and other college-related expenses.

Operation Homefront is proud to announce Operation Homefront’s Military Spouse Scholarship Program.
The scholarships will be awarded to recipients on August 15, 2009. Selection for the scholarship will be
made by a panel of judges and the award will be scored in three areas: the applicant’s response to the
essay question, his or her commitment to volunteerism and grade point average. Applicants must follow
instructions carefully and complete the application in its entirety in order to be considered.
The scholarship award is offered to spouses of uniformed service members to attend a four-year college
or university, graduate school, accredited trade school, certificate program, vocational school or
community college. Thirty seven scholarships are currently being offered, totaling $100,000. The winner
of the grand prize scholarship will receive $10,000; two first-place award winners will receive $7,500; four
second-place award winners will receive $5,000; 10 third-place award winners will receive $2,500; and
20 runners up will each receive $1,500. The scholarship funds may be used to assist with tuition, fees
and books and will be paid directly to the educational institution. Applicants must resubmit an application
each year they would like to be considered.

Purpose
To provide scholarships to students who are pursuing a career in perioperative nursing and to registered nurses who are interested in
and committed to perioperative nursing to continue their education by pursuing a bachelor’s, master’s or doctoral degree in nursing or a
complementary field.
Eligibility
Nursing Student— At the time of application the applicant must be enrolled in an accredited program as a nursing major for the
2009-10 academic year (July 1, 2009-June 30, 2010). Acceptance into a pre-nursing program only does not qualify; applicant must
have completed program pre-requisites. The applicant must be in a program leading to initial licensure as an RN. The applicant must
be pursuing a career in the field of perioperative/surgical nursing. This interest and/or experience must be clearly demonstrated in the
personal statement. Application deadline date is June 15, 2009.
Bachelors— At the time of application the applicant must be enrolled in an accredited bachelors degree program in nursing for the
2009-10 academic year (July 1, 2009-June 30, 2010). The applicant must have a current license to practice as a registered nurse and
must have a commitment to perioperative nursing. The applicant must have a current AORN membership by application deadline date
(June 15, 2009)
Masters— At the time of application the applicant must be enrolled in an accredited masters degree program in nursing or in an
accredited masters degree program in another discipline for the 2009-10 academic year (July 1, 2009-June 30, 2010). The applicant
must have a current license to practice as a registered nurse and must have a commitment to perioperative nursing. The applicant must
have a current AORN membership by application deadline date (June 15, 2009)
Doctoral— At the time of application the candidate must be enrolled in a doctoral program in an accredited university for the 2009-10
academic year (July 1, 2009-June 30, 2010). The applicant must have a current license to practice as a registered nurse and must have
a commitment to perioperative nursing. The applicant must have a current AORN membership by application deadline date (June 15,
2009)
Awards
The number of awards and amount of the awards will be determined annually. Awards are not renewable. The scholarships will be
applied to educational expenses including tuition, fees and books. Winners will be required to submit grades and invoices for these
allowable expenses corresponding to each semester no later than August 1, 2010.
Winner Selection
A Selection Committee appointed by AORN President-elect will evaluate the applications and select the winners by a blind review
process. The use of this committee is designed to ensure the impartiality and confidentiality of the selection process. In evaluating the
applicants, the committee will consider the applicants’ academics/transcripts and personal statement.
